Thimerosal induces toxic reaction in non-sensitized animals

Summary
Thimerosal injection caused swelling and inflammation in animal models, indicating a toxic effect. This mercury-induced reaction may contribute to hypersensitivity and vaccine side-effects.

Background:
- Thimerosal is a mercury-containing preservative used in vaccines.
- Concerns exist regarding potential hypersensitivity reactions to thimerosal.
Purpose of the Study:
- To investigate the toxic effects of thimerosal injection in nonsensitized animals.
- To determine if mercury in thimerosal causes inflammatory responses.
Main Methods:
- Intrafootpad injections of thimerosal solution in mice.
- Cutaneous injections of thimerosal solution in rats.
- Histopathological examination of injection sites.
- Comparison with mercuric chloride, methyl mercury, and thiosalicylic acid.
Main Results:
- Thimerosal induced significant swelling and edema in mice.
- Histopathology revealed polymorphonuclear neutrophil infiltration.
- Increased vascular permeability was observed in rats.
- Mercury compounds caused reactions, while thiosalicylic acid did not.
Conclusions:
- The observed reactions are attributed to the mercury content of thimerosal.
- Thimerosal's toxic effects may contribute to hypersensitivity reactions in patients.
- Thimerosal as a vaccine preservative might exacerbate vaccination side-effects.
